Indulge in the sweet, flaky layers of Kunafa, a beloved Middle Eastern dessert made with kataifi pastry, creamy ricotta, and a drizzle of fragrant sugar syrup. Perfect for festive gatherings or a cozy evening treat.
IngredientsWhat you need
- 500 grams kataifi pastry
- 200 grams unsalted butter
- 400 grams ricotta cheese
- 100 grams s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 300 ml sugar syrup
- 50 grams pistachios
Method
- 1
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F).
- 2
In a large bowl, mix the kataifi pastry with melted butter until evenly coated.
- 3
In another bowl, combine the ricotta cheese, sugar, and vanilla extract. Mix well until smooth.
- 4
In a greased baking dish, layer half of the buttered kataifi pastry on the bottom, pressing down to form an even base.
- 5
Spread the cheese mixture evenly over the kataifi layer, then top with the remaining kataifi pastry.
- 6
Bake in the preheated oven for about 30-35 minutes, or until the top is golden brown.
- 7
Once baked, remove from the oven and immediately pour the sugar syrup over the hot kunafa evenly.
- 8
Let it sit for a few minutes, then garnish with crushed pistachios before serving.
